**๐ŸŽ™๏ธ Speakers:๐ŸŽ™๏ธ Speakers:** Thomas Wiecki, PhD, Luca Fiaschi, PhD, and**โฐ Time:** 15:00 UTC / 8:00 AM PT / 11:00 AM ET / 5:00 PM Berlin Traditional MCMC methods like NUTS are the gold standard for parameter estimation, but they hit a wall when dealing with intractable likelihoods, complex simulation models, or real-time production demands where sampling cannot afford to take minutes or hours. Enter Amortized Bayesian Inference (ABI): a paradigm shift where generative AI architectures (such as Normalizing Flows, Diffusion Models, and Flow Matching) are trained offline to learn complex posterior distributions. Once trained, inference becomes a fast forward pass.
